WebMay 24, 2024 · Janet Guthrie changed motor sports when, in 1977, she became the first woman to qualify for and compete in the Indianapolis 500 at Indianapolis Motor …

WebMay 29, 2024 · On May 29, 1977, Janet Guthrie became the first woman to compete in the Indianapolis 500. She completed 27 laps before her car became disabled. By UPI Staff 1/4 Janet Guthrie was the... WebMay 27, 2024 · Janet Guthrie was the first to qualifyand compete in it in 1977, and her best finish was ninth in 1978.
